Customized excavator helps Indonesian steel plant hit close to 100% recycling

Nine Volvo CE machines, including a specially adapted excavator, have helped a steel producer in Cilegon, Indonesia recycle over 97% of the waste material from its steel-making process. In the two years since the machines arrived the customer is reporting excellent success.

MEE's Indian foray

My Eco Energy (MEE) recently announced its foray into the Indian bio fuel industry. By making bio-diesel, a bio-fuel, made from waste materials including vegetable oils and animal fat available for consumer and commercial use, MEE moves one step closer to its goal of reducing dependence on traditional fuel mediums in India.
